Does Mrs Maple pay out redemptions?

On the record we hold, yes. The 1 published complaint ended with the player paid in full. A $1,000 redemption sat in processing for seven days and then ran into a region-availability message at login; the balance was settled in stages, with the final payment made by bank transfer and confirmed received on August 18, 2026.

Does Mrs Maple respond to complaint mediation?

Yes, though not through the address you would expect. Its player support desk answered inside twenty minutes with a holding notice and never followed up with anything case-specific. The operator's wider team engaged properly, stayed with the case for two weeks, answered direct questions, corrected its own position when challenged, and produced a resolution.

Has Mrs Maple ever withdrawn an allegation against a player?

Yes. In the published case the operator alleged reward farming. When SweepsGuard asked for the dates, the session references and the specific term relied on, it reviewed the account again, concluded there had been sufficient gameplay between purchases, and withdrew the allegation. It also kept the player's self-exclusion in place at our request so he never had to reactivate the account to be paid.

What should I do if a Mrs Maple redemption is stuck?

Keep every record from submission through to payment, because that is what made the published case winnable. Redeem in smaller amounts rather than letting a balance build, and note the $100 minimum. Is Mrs Maple safe to play at?

Mrs Maple holds a grade C on SweepsGuard. The record is short but it is positive: the published complaint resolved in the player's favor, against an operator still building a payout history and excluding an unusually wide list of states. Confirm your state is eligible before you play.
